5 benefits of offering Taraweeh

Taraweeh is one of the most auspicious and long-awaited events in Ramadan. It is celebrated in different shapes and fashions across the world, while some offer 20 rakaats Taraweeh daily and some offer 8.

Overall, Taraweeh is one of the most unique events during Ramadan and offers some benefits that Muslims must take advantage of it. Here are five absolutely amazing benefits of offering Taraweeh during the holy month of Ramadan:

You can hear the Holy Quran

The holy Quran is the most precious book in the world. It is intended to be a guide for humanity until the end of time and serve as a manual for becoming an ideal Muslim. The holy Quran also has a huge barakaat. After all, it is Allah’s word and therefore brings a special blessing that Allah summarized to the Quran. There is no better way to spend Ramadan than to stand in front of the Almighty for a long time every day and listen to his words.

You follow two Sunnahs of the Holy Prophet

Holy Prophet used to give Taraweeh every day of the month of Ramadan, and during these 29/30 days, he used to listen to the entire Holy Quran. The sunnah of the Holy Prophet is the most recommended activity for Muslims after fardh, and therefore it is essential that we invoke the joy and happiness of Allah in the auspicious month by following the act of His beloved prophet.

Taraweeh makes salah much easier

Whether you offer 8 rakaats or 20 rakaats of Taraweeh during Ramadan, it is always more than the number of rakaats you give throughout the year. Thus, Taraweeh becomes a means by which the opportunity of offering Salah has increased as one used to stand in prayer for long periods of time during Taraweeh. It can therefore be seen as a means by which one can practice making Salah offerings regularly throughout the year, and thus beneficial in really restructuring our lives. And make us more active and responsible Muslims throughout the year, not just during Ramadan.

It’s also good exercise

We frequently laze around during Ramadan and as a result, fail to get the required workout to stay healthy. That, coupled with the standard overeating that we do in the course of the Iftar and Sehri approach that it’s miles important that we get a few workouts. In that, offering Taraweeh is killing birds with one stone. Consistency in Taraweeh will help you stay on track and stay active. It helps us get physical benefits.
